The Dermis: A Vital Player in Wound Healing

The dermis, located beneath the epidermis, is a dense, fibrous connective tissue. It is a dynamic layer, constantly undergoing renewal and repair. This layer is rich in blood vessels, nerves, hair follicles, sweat glands, and collagen fibers, all of which contribute to its vital role in wound healing. When a wound occurs, the dermis is the first to respond, initiating a complex cascade of events aimed at restoring the damaged tissue.

Inflammation: The Initial Response

The initial phase of wound healing is characterized by inflammation, a crucial process that helps to clear the wound of debris and pathogens. The dermis, with its abundant blood supply, facilitates the influx of immune cells, such as neutrophils and macrophages, to the wound site. These cells engulf and destroy bacteria, dead cells, and other foreign materials, preventing infection and preparing the wound for repair.

Proliferation: Building New Tissue

Following the inflammatory phase, the dermis enters the proliferative phase, where new tissue is formed. Fibroblasts, the primary cells responsible for collagen synthesis, migrate to the wound site and begin producing collagen fibers. These fibers form a scaffold that provides structural support and strength to the healing wound. Blood vessels also proliferate, delivering oxygen and nutrients to the newly forming tissue.

Remodeling: Strengthening the Wound

The final phase of wound healing is remodeling, where the newly formed tissue is strengthened and refined. Collagen fibers are reorganized and cross-linked, increasing the tensile strength of the wound. The dermis also undergoes a process of contraction, bringing the wound edges closer together. Over time, the scar tissue gradually fades, leaving behind a less noticeable mark.
